Claims
- 1. A computer-implemented method for deriving a desired plan for scheduling a use of available resources to satisfy one or more demands for goods or services, said method comprising:describing an environment which models the available resources and alternative ways to utilize said resources to reach objectives; defining each of the demands as one or more orders where each of the orders has one or more line items; scheduling the demands according to a set of possible plans based upon the environment; and evaluating each possible plan of said set of possible plans for purpose of either (a) accepting the possible plan being evaluated because it is desired to be implemented, or (b) rejecting the possible plan being evaluated.
- 2. The method of claim 1 wherein said step of describing an environment further comprises:describing each of the available resources and a capacity of each of the available resources; and describing a utilization structure which describes the use and limitations on use of substantially all of the available resources.
- 3. The method of claim 2 wherein the step of describing an environment further comprises describing one or more customers associated with the demands.
- 4. The method of claim 2 wherein the step of describing a utilization structure further comprises describing the utilization structure in terms of an objective having one or more sequences having one or more operations having one or more steps, where each step may be associated with relationships and with requirements.
- 5. A method according to claim 1 wherein the step of scheduling the demands further comprises the steps of:associating the plan with the environment and the demand; and selecting which of the one or more orders to schedule; and scheduling the selected orders.
- 6. A method according to claim 5 wherein the step of scheduling the demands further comprises, for each selected order, the steps of:creating activity lists for one or more sequences, each sequence having one or more operations and each operation having one or more steps, where each step may be associated with one or more relationship and with one or more requirements; creating opportunities for each line item of the selected orders, each opportunity having associated with it one or more activities; selecting opportunities; scheduling the activities associated with the selected opportunities; verifying each selected opportunity for which the associated activities were successfully scheduled; and correlating each of the activities of the verified selected opportunities to the selected order.
- 7. The method according to claim 6 wherein the step of creating activity lists further comprises:selecting a sequence from the one or more sequences; selecting one or more of the operations of the selected sequence; selecting one or more of the steps of the selected operations; creating an activity based upon the selected steps, the activity having one or more requirements associated therewith and the one or more requirements each having a resource associated therewith; selecting relevant requirements from said associated requirements; adding the selected requirements to the created activity; selecting one or more relationships; and adding the selected relationships to the created activity.
- 8. The method of claim 6 wherein the step of creating opportunities comprises:selecting one of the activity lists; selecting an activity from the selected activity list; creating an opportunity for the selected activity; and adding the created opportunity to the line item.
- 9. The method according to claim 6 wherein the step of scheduling activities comprises:selecting a requirement from the one or more requirements associated with one of the activities associated with the selected opportunities; creating the resource associated with the selected requirement, said resource having an availability state; determining how to allocate the created resource to an activity associated with the selected opportunities; updating the availability state of the created resource; and adding the created resource to the determined activity.
- 10. The method according to claim 1 wherein the step of defining demands comprises:selecting a demand where the demand may be chosen from a one or more default plans or a new demand may be created and selected; and creating one or more orders specifying the selected demand, each of the one or more orders having one or more line items.
- 11. The method according to claim 1 wherein the step of evaluating the plan comprises:inspecting the relationship between the selected plan and each of the demand and the resources, including what resources will be used in executing the plan; determining whether the demand is adequately satisfied; comparing the demand to the resources which will be used in executing the plan; and determining whether the plan is satisfactory based in part on results of one or more of said steps of inspecting the relationships, determining whether demand is satisfied, and comparing the demand to the resources.
- 12. A computer program product having a computer readable medium having computer readable code recorded thereon for solving finite capacity problems in a variety of different environments, said computer readable code comprising:first receiving means for receiving information about available resources; second receiving means for receiving information about demands; modeling means for modeling an environment based upon (a) said information about said available resources and (b) said information about said demands, said environment describing alternative ways to utilize said resources to reach objectives; defining means for defining said demands as one or more orders where each of said orders has one or more line items; scheduling means for scheduling the demands according to a set of possible plans based upon said environment; and evaluating means for evaluating each possible plan of said set of possible plans for the purpose of either (a) accepting said possible plan being evaluated because it is desired to be implemented, or (b) rejecting said possible plan being evaluated.
- 13. The computer program product of claim 12 further comprising:object centers having (a) means for updating and storing said information about available resources and (b) means for updating and storing said information about demands; and means for updating said plan responsive to updating said information about available resources and said information about demands.
- 14. The computer program product of claim 13 wherein:said means for updating and storing said information about available resources comprises one or more schema, each schema having one or more tables where each table comprises one or more rows and one or more columns, and wherein the intersection of one of said one or more rows and one of said one or more columns forms a data cell capable of storing some of said information about available resources; and said means for updating and storing said information about demand comprises one or more schema, each schema having one or more tables where each table comprises one or more rows and one or more columns, and wherein an intersection of one of said one or more rows and one of said one or more columns forms a data cell capable of storing some of said information about demand.
- 15. The computer program product of claim 12 further comprising:a framework having plural class libraries hierarchically arranged with respect to each of said other plural class libraries such that a first class library hierarchically adjacent to a second class library is with respect to said second class library one of the group of a parent, a sibling, or an offspring; wherein each class library comprises one or more routines, each routine having a functionality; and wherein each class library inherits said functionalities of each offspring class library.
- 16. A computer-implemented method for deriving at least one plan for scheduling a use of available resources to satisfy one or more demands for goods or services, said method comprising:a step for describing an environment, said environment modeling the available resources; a step for defining each of the demands as one or more orders where each of the orders has one or more line items; a step for scheduling the demands based upon the environment according to a possible plan; and a step for evaluating the possible plan for purpose of either (a) accepting the possible plan, or (b) rejecting the possible plan and initiating steps for creating a new plan.
- 17. The method according to claim 16, wherein said environment comprises:a description of each of the available resources and a capacity of each of the available resources; and a description of a utilization structure which defines the use and limitations on use of substantially all of the available resources.
- 18. The method according to claim 16, wherein demand may be chosen from a one or more default plans or a new demand may be created and selected; and wherein said demand comprise one or more orders having one or more line items.
- 19. The method according to claim 16, wherein the steps for describing, defining, scheduling and evaluating are repeated for a given demand until said possible plan is accepted.
